
The Sensex ended the day lower by 145 points, while the Nifty fell 40 points in trade. The top loser from the Nifty pack was Tata Motors which slid almost 5 per cent, while Wipro fell after a poor set of quarterly results. Other stocks that dropped in trade were the metal pack with Hindalco, Tata Steel and Sesa Sterlite among the losers.
Heavyweight, Reliance also fell after rallying sharply in the last few days. Select Nifty stocks that gained ground in trade were Hindustan Unilever, Hero Motor Corp, Mahindra and Mahindra and Sun Pharma.
The hardest hit in trade today were the PSU banking stocks after Punjab National Bank and Allahabad Bank both reported their results. Bank of India, Syndicate Bank and IDBI Bank were the hardest hit. Select mid cap stocks also saw selling pressure with Ashok Leyland, Jain Irrigation and Power finance the hardest hit. Biocon closed the day a huge 7 per cent lower after its results failed to impress the markets.
The Bank Nifty also saw losses after most of the banking stocks dropped. However, Kotak Mahindra managed to end the day with gains.
Meanwhile, European markets were trading marginally lower with the German DAX, the French CAC and the UK's FTSE lower.
